1. Jack Wilshere To Aston Villa
What’s the story?
Jack Wilshere and Arsenal were a pair that not so long ago, were inseparable to say the least. However, situations have led to things taking drastic turns for the player, who is now looking for a move outside the Emirates. In what has emerged as a surprising rumour, Mirror reports that Aston Villa are eyeing a transfer for the English midfielder.
Should the deal take place?
The player spent last season on loan with AFC Bournemouth, and has had major injury concerns and woes that have kept him away from football at Arsenal. While things look increasingly weak with the Gunners, the player is destined for a move somewhere else, and Steve Bruce considers it as the perfect opportunity to convince him to drop a division and join his Villa side. It might be a difficult task to achieve for the Championship team at the moment, but John Terry’s presence as captain and lack of opportunities in North London might force him into thinking about the decision long and hard.
Possibility of it happening
The possibility of Jack Wilshere moving to Aston Villa is currently no higher than that of 4/10.
2. Vincent Janssen To Stoke City
What’s the story?
After having a relatively quiet summer transfer window so far, Stoke City finally seem to be prepared to get into the mix of things before time runs out. With the month reaching its business end, Sky Sports reporter Dharmesh Sheth has reported that Vincent Janssen has emerged as a potential target for Mark Hughes’ side. The player is yet to hit form as a Spurs striker, but is still considered as the answer to the goal-scoring problems Stoke currently face.
Should the deal take place?
Mauricio Pochettino is yet to make a single signing so far this season, and in order to improve his club’s financial situation, selling Janssen might be the right way to go about things. Tottenham do have Harry Kane and Son Heung-min in their ranks to bag goals for the club, and could use the money from their number 9’s sale to bring in another player that can find the back of the net on a regular basis. The deal sounds like a win-win situation for everyone involved, and should reach a positive conclusion.
Possibility of it happening
The chances of Victor Janssen heading to the Britannia Stadium are currently 8/10.
3. Ryan Sessegnon To Tottenham Hotspur
What’s the story?
With three quarters of the transfer window over and no player brought in so far, times are desperate for Tottenham Hotspur this summer. Furthermore, to add salt to the wounds of those fans waiting for good news, the Telegraph mentioned that the club has seen a bid rejected for teenage left-back Ryan Sessegnon. Fulham disapproved of a £25 million offer for their defender, and hope to keep him till 2020, when his current contract expires.
Should the deal take place?
The player has made 26 appearances in the Championship last term, and seems to be packed with abilities to play for a Premier League side this season. However, moving to a club and fighting for first team football behind Danny Rose and Ben Davies might not be the best thing for his career at such an early and progressive stage. Pochettino is eager to strengthen his defence for next season, but Sessegnon does not seem to come around as the answer for that particular problem in the minds of many.
Possibility of it happening
The chances of the player leaving Fulham and coming to Wembley are currently 5/10.
4. Cedric Soares To Chelsea
What’s the story?
After a dismal start to their Premier League defence campaign against Burnley, Chelsea and Antonio Conte seem to be taking immediate actions by digging into their pockets and heading right into the transfer market. According to reports mentioned in Telegraph, Cedric Soares from Southampton has emerged as an ideal target for the North London club, and is being chased with a price tag of £15 million on his back.
Should the deal take place?
The player has proven Premier League durability and experience, and could use his versatility to help stabilise things at Stamford Bridge with immediate effect. Given his reasonable price and skill set, purchasing him might be the perfect bargain for Conte and his team.
Possibility of it happening
The possibility of Soares leaving the Saints and coming to Chelsea is currently 6/10.
